The three-toed sloth is the world's slowest mammal. At the top speed of 2.4 meters per minute would it take to travel 1.2 km (1200 meters)?

To determine how long it would take for a three-toed sloth to travel 1.2 kilometers (1200 meters) at a speed of 2.4 meters per minute, you can use the formula:

\[ \text{Time} = \frac{\text{Distance}}{\text{Speed}} \]

Substituting the values:

  • Distance = 1200 meters
  • Speed = 2.4 meters per minute

Now, calculating the time:

\[ \text{Time} = \frac{1200 \text{ m}}{2.4 \text{ m/min}} = 500 \text{ minutes} \]

Therefore, it would take the three-toed sloth 500 minutes to travel 1.2 kilometers. If you want to express this in hours, you can convert minutes to hours:

\[ 500 \text{ minutes} \div 60 \text{ minutes/hour} \approx 8.33 \text{ hours} \]

So, the sloth would take approximately 8.33 hours to travel 1.2 kilometers.
